How to Share Your Canva Images With Me (So I Can Download Them Properly)
If your logo or images are saved in Canva, this is the easiest way to send them to me.
Step-by-step
Open your design in Canva
Click Share (top right)
Under Link sharing, choose Anyone with the link
Set access to Can view (not edit)
Click Copy link
Paste the link into an email and send it to me
Important
Please make sure the link is set to Can view
This protects your design and keeps your Canva account safe
I can download the files in the correct sizes and formats for your website
